Cyclangan, oprindeligt udviklet til ikke-overvåget billed-til-billedoversættelse, kan faktisk tilpasses til tekst-til-tekst-oversættelsesopgaver, herunder overførsel af tekststil og overførsel af neurale maskine, dog med nogle vigtige sondringer og udfordringer sammenlignet med dens billedbaserede applikationer.
CycleGan er bemærkelsesværdig for sin evne til at lære kortlægninger mellem to domæner uden at kræve parrede træningseksempler, der adresserer en betydelig udfordring i mange tekstopgaver, hvor store parallelle corpora (parrede teksteksempler) muligvis ikke er tilgængelige. CycleGan fungerer ved at lære to kortlægninger: en fra domæne A til domæne B og et sekund fra domæne B til domæne A ved hjælp af modstridende træning. En nøgleinnovation er Cycle Consistens -tabet, der sikrer, at når en prøve kortlægges fra det ene domæne til det andet og tilbage igen, vender den tilbage til det originale input. Denne cykliske begrænsning hjælper med at opretholde indholdskonsistens på trods af at arbejde med uparrede data.
Anvendelse til tekststiloverførsel
Overførsel af tekststil er processen med at omformulere indhold i en ny stil, samtidig med at det originale indhold og mening bevarer det originale indhold og mening. I betragtning af vanskeligheden med at opnå parrede tekstdata, hvor den samme sætning er skrevet i flere stilarter, er Cyclan's uparrede træningsmetodik især fordelagtig. Forskere har implementeret CycleGan-baserede modeller til stiloverførsel mellem forskellige skrivestilarter, såsom forskellige forfatteres poesi eller skiftende følelsespolaritet (f.eks. Fra positiv til negativ stemning og vice versa).
I eksperimenter med Yelp -anmeldelser demonstrerede en cykelgan tilpasset til overførsel af tekststil (undertiden kaldet textcykelgan) evnen til at producere flydende og stilistisk nøjagtige transformationer uden at kræve parallel tekst. Modellen lærte overførsel af tovejsstil oversættelse af positive anmeldelser til negative og det omvendte, mens det stort set opretholder det originale indhold. Imidlertid er ydeevnen ujævn, med nogle overførsler (f.eks. Negativt til positiv), der opnår højere nøjagtighed end det modsatte, hvilket indikerer udfordringer i stil og indholdsoplysning i tekst versus billeder.
Arkitekturen inkorporerer generatorer og diskriminatorer, der er specialiseret til tekstdata, ofte ved hjælp af indlejringer eller sekvensmodeller til at repræsentere tekst. Cykluskonsistenstab opfordrer den oversatte tekst, når den oversættes tilbage, til at give den originale tekst, som hjælper med at bevare semantisk betydning under stilændringer. På trods af løftet forbliver perfekte stiloverførsel i tekst udfordrende med lejlighedsvis tilbageholdelse af originale sentimentord eller generering af neutral tekst i stedet for korrekt stilistisk transformation.
CycleGan til Neural Machine Translation (NMT)
CycleGan-principper er også blevet udvidet til neural maskineoversættelse, især for ikke-parallel korpora. Traditionelle overvågede NMT er stærkt afhængig af store parrede datasæt, som ikke er tilgængelige for mange sprogpar. Ved at anvende Cycle Consistens-tab trænes modeller til at oversætte sætninger fra sprog A til sprog B og tilbage til sprog A, med det mål, at denne rundtur-oversættelse rekonstruerer den originale tekst trofast.
Et nyligt eksempel er CycleGn Framework, en transformerbaseret arkitektur inspireret af Cyclegan. Den introducerer en cyklus konsistent tilgang til maskinoversættelse, der ikke kræver parallel tekstkorpora. To modeller er trænet samtidigt: en, der oversætter fra kilden til målsproget, og en anden model for det modsatte. Uddannelsesmålet opfordrer oversættelsesprocessen til at være invertible, hvilket betyder, at bagud oversættelse genskaber det originale input. Denne tilgang har vist lovende resultater i indlæringsoversættelsesopgaver på tværs af sprogpar med ujusterede datasæt, hvilket gør det til en overbevisende vej til lav ressource og underrepræsenterede sprog.
Udfordringer og tilpasninger til tekst
Mens CycleGan -rammen er konceptuelt overførbar fra billeder til tekst, præsenterer tekstdata unikke udfordringer:
- Diskret repræsentation: Billeder er kontinuerlige værdsatte data, hvilket tillader glatte gradientstrømme, der er nødvendige i GAN-træning; Teksten er diskrete, hvilket kræver indlejringer og undertiden forstærkningslæring eller gradientestimeringsteknikker til at håndtere diskrete tokenudgange.
- Bevarelse af semantik: I modsætning til billeder, hvor stilarter hovedsageligt vedrører udseende, kræver tekst at bevare semantisk betydning, mens du ændrer stil, hvilket er mere kompliceret på grund af nuancer i sprog, grammatik og kontekst.
- Evalueringsmålinger: Tekstevaluering involverer flydende, indholdsbevaring og stilnøjagtighed, som er subjektiv og sværere at kvantificere sammenlignet med pixelniveau-nøjagtighed i billeder.
- Modelarkitektur: Generatorer og diskriminatorer for tekst skal håndtere sekventielle data ved hjælp af modeller som LSTMS, GRUS eller Transformers. Cyclan's originale indviklingsnetværk skal tilpasses i overensstemmelse hermed.
Resumé af brugssager
- Tekststiloverførsel: Cyclegan er blevet anvendt med succes på at overføre tekststil uden parrede data, såsom stemning overførsel eller forfatterstiltransformation, opretholdelse af en balance mellem indholdsopbevaring og stilistisk ændring.
- Uovervåget Neural Machine Translation: Ved håndhævelse af cykluskonsistens kan CycleGan-inspirerede modeller lære oversættelseskortlægning fra uparret tosproget Corpora, hvilket letter behovet for dyre parallelle datasæt.
-Tekst-til-billed- og billed-til-tekst: Relaterede multimodale opgaver bruger cykluskonsistens til at generere billeder fra tekst og billedtekster fra billeder, der viser Cyclan's alsidighed i håndtering af tekstdatadomæner.
Advances and Research Outlook
Nylig forskning fortsætter med at tilpasse og forbedre CyclanGan til tekstopgaver ved at integrere bedre træning på sekvensniveau, selvovervåget læring og transformerbaserede arkitekturer. Bestræbelser fokuserer på at forbedre stilindhold disentangement, træningsstabilitet og oversættelsesnøjagtighed, især for sprog med lav ressource eller domæner, hvor parallel dataknaphed er uoverkommelig.
Afslutningsvis kan Cyclangan effektivt bruges til tekst-til-tekst-oversættelse og stiloverførsel, udnytte uparrede data gennem cykluskonsistenstab og modstridende træning. Dette gør det til et kraftfuldt værktøj til NLP -opgaver, hvor det er vanskeligt at få parret korpora, hvilket muliggør oversættelser og transformationer, der opretholder semantisk indhold, mens det ændrer stil eller sprog. Tilpasninger til diskrete data, semantisk konservering og evalueringskompleksiteter differentierer tekstapplikationer fra billedbaserede CyclanGan-anvendelser. Disse igangværende udviklinger udvider CycleGan's værktøj inden for tekstdomænet.
Referencer:- "Tilpasning af CycleGan -arkitekturen til overførsel af tekststil," Miché La Lorandi et al., Dublin City University.
- "CycleGn: En cyklus konsistent tilgang til neural maskineoversættelse," Sã¶ren Dré Ano et al., ACL 2024.
-"Tekst-til-image-til-tekst-oversættelse ved hjælp af cyklus konsistent GaN," ARXIV 2018.
-"Selvovervåget tekststiloverførsel ved hjælp af cyklus-konsistente GaN," ACM 2024.